WebMar 27, 2015 · The name axolotl is believed to come from the ancient Aztec language nahuatl, and translates roughly as “water monster.”. WebMay 24, 2024 · Axolotls can grow on average to a length of 9 inches (20 centimeters), but some have grown to more than 12 inches (30 cm) long. In captivity, the salamanders live an average of 5 to 6 years, but ...
